Output fcb66f55ea0f7e312f8220030cb74c86f97a8ca7ddba127295c687067ae56d39:185

value
65156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e0ea239ddcd9df25dc2bc1ccac48dc993a81b1 OP_EQUAL
address
3DzBubAQHfuNDXTCrbXjYk7BwFwGqZHnrg
transaction
fcb66f55ea0f7e312f8220030cb74c86f97a8ca7ddba127295c687067ae56d39